What are inventory jobs?

You can find inventory jobs in many fields, such as manufacturing, warehouse distribution, and retail, to name just a few. Although your specific duties may vary slightly by field, most people who work in inventory have similar responsibilities. These include ensuring that products or the raw materials for manufacturing remain in stock, keeping track of orders and supply levels, and performing routine quality control inspections of inventory storage areas to ensure there are no issues with the materials. You record your work and present reports to your supervisors about inventory levels or changes in supply or demand.

What is the difference between Inventory vs Warehouse Associate?

AspectInventoryWarehouse Associate
Primary RoleManaging stock levels, tracking inventory, and overseeing inventory accuracyHandling goods, packing, shipping, and assisting in warehouse operations
Required SkillsInventory management, data entry, organizational skillsPhysical stamina, forklift operation, basic logistics
Work EnvironmentOffice-based with warehouse oversightPhysical warehouse setting
CertificationsInventory management systems, sometimes forklift certificationForklift certification often required

While both roles are integral to warehouse operations, Inventory focuses on stock control and accuracy, whereas Warehouse Associates handle the physical movement and management of goods. How you'll support our operations:
At Misfits Market, our customers choose us for what we - quite literally - bring to the table: foods that may look a little different but are still fresh and safe to eat. The Inventory Associate is responsible for safely and accurately moving products through the warehouse.
The Inventory Associate reports to the Inventory Supervisor and is an important member of the FC operations team. By maintaining accurate product counts and movement within the fulfillment center, the Inventory Associate helps ensure our customers receive the entirety of their grocery order each week.

What you'll be doing:
  • Works closely with the receiving and quality control teams to unload and verify inbound inventory of commodities.
  • Enforces FIFO (First-In-First-Out) practices in the warehouse to ensure product quality and freshness for our customers.
  • Partners with other departments to complete cycle counts and inventory audits on a regular basis.
  • Research and document inventory discrepancies, escalating to Inventory Supervisor when necessary
  • Supports the on-time delivery of customer orders by maintaining optimal product inventory levels in all areas of the facility.
  • Follows all applicable regulations to maintain a safe and healthy workplace while operating PIT equipment and storing food.
  • Diligently adheres to all established facility food safety rules, personal hygiene standards, and Good Distribution Practices (GDP) expectations daily.
  • Promptly escalates food safety hazards and takes immediate action to halt production lines if product integrity is compromised or suspected of being compromised.
